摘要
The study investigates how Zr additions and process annealing affect mechanical and corrosion properties of AA5083 Al-Mg alloys by microstructural examination, tensile strength, hardness testing and ASTM G67 nitric acid mass loss test. In the present work, process annealing temperatures were set to 220 degrees C and 250 degrees C. The results show that the hardness and tensile properties of Zr-containing cold rolled alloy were superior to that of Zr-free cold rolled alloy before and after process annealing treatment and sensitization heat treatment. Unfortunately, adding Zr to AA5383 alloy significantly degraded the corrosion resistance of the Zr-containing cold rolled alloy annealed at 220 degrees C. For improving corrosion resistance of Zr-containing alloy, annealing temperature could be increased to 250 degrees C to avoid a marked drop in the corrosion resistance.
